UK Border Agency suspends 'flawed' asylum DNA testing

,----[ Quote ]
| The UK Border Agency has quietly suspended its
| heavily-criticised attempt to test asylum seekers'
| nationality by DNA fingerprinting and isotope
| analysis.
|
| Officials have been told that the "Human Provenance
| Pilot", described as "naive and scientifically
| flawed" by Sir Alec Jeffreys, the inventor of DNA
| fingerprinting, has been "temporarily suspended".
`----

Castrol roadside billboard ANPR snoopvertising - another DVLA database privacy scandal

,----[ Quote ]
| Remember that the definition of "personal data" includes
| partially or poorly "anonymised data", which
| can easily be cross referenced with another system
| e.g. Vehicle Number Plate and just the first part
| of the Post Code of the Registered Keeper address
| will be enough to identify the driver , in most
| cases.
`----
